“Statutory net worth” or “net worth” means the sum of the following: (a) Issued and outstanding capital stock. (b) Issued and outstanding capital certificates. (c) Paid-in surplus. (d) Retained earnings. (e) Pledged savings accounts of a mutual association with the approval of the commissioner. (f) General reserves and other amounts as the commissioner prescribes.
